Summary/Abstract: This paper aims to share the main results of the research which intended to explore the current strategies and models on a special area of the “internal cross-border communication” of international companies, operating in different socio-cultural environments. This study was designed to examine what strategies are available for CEOs to guide the communication in different socio-cultural environments. The research aimed to investigate the theme of “standardization or differentiation”. It was written on the basis of systematic expert interview made by CEOs of international companies having subsidiaries in Hungary.
